Daoxian Massacre The Daoxian massacre (), or Dao County massacre, was a massacre which took place during the Cultural Revolution in Dao County, Hunan as well as ten other nearby counties and cities. From August 13 to October 17, 1967, a total of 7,696 people were k ...
, in which more than 9,000 people died from August to October in 1967. * Shaoyang County Massacre, in which 991 people died from July to September in 1968 (some scholars have pointed out that thousands of people died in reality). {{disambiguation
